Fulfillment Cycle Counter

Chippewa Falls, United States

JOB SUMMARY:
Mason Companies Cycle Counter is responsible for monitoring warehouse inventory and performing cycle counting duties to ensure that all materials are properly verified and are reflective of reported inventory. The Cycle Counter will maintain inventory accuracy through proper counting, processing of material reports and transfers. The cycle Counter will also assist the fulfillment team members and Customer Service teams in locating materials.

P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ONBILITIES:
The below listing of essential functions is not an inclusive listing of all duties that may be requested to be performed by supervisor or manager.
  • Perform daily cycle counts to ensure that all inventory is properly verified and are reflective of reported inventory
  • Assist in researching inventory discrepancies and submit accurate inventory and bin location reports.
  • Assist in determining root causes on inventory discrepancies and help implement corrective actions to eliminate repetitive errors.
  • Responsible for answering Customer Service, Fulfillment, and Sourcing inquiries in a timely manner.
  • Assist in updating dims and weights for all materials in the STEP database.
  • Be able to drive the order picker and other warehouse equipment carefully and safely to perform the cycle routing role as defined.
  • Assist in monitoring and controlling inventory practices to ensure accuracy.
  • Assist in maintaining product identification and location programs.
SECONDARY R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Perform returns and shipping position functions as requested.
  • Attend all department and company meetings as required.
The above listing of essential and periodic functions is not an inclusive listing of all duties that may be required to be performed.

E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E:
  • Associates degree in business administration or Business analytics
  • At least 1 year of related inventory and/or material handling experience in fulfillment environment
  • At least 1 year of experience using an ERP (Oracle EBS) system to find, troubleshoot, and maintain inventory accuracy
  • Mature PC skills with the ability to navigate from one screen to another. Microsoft Office – Word and Excel knowledge
  • Ability to work accurately and efficiently in the counting, researching and root cause analysis of Mason inventories.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S:
  • Requires continuous standing and frequent walking.
  • Wearing the fall arrest harness if using Stock picker to conduct audits
  • Requires frequent twisting, stooping/bending at the waist and squatting.
  • Requires normal hearing and sight on a continuous basis.
  • Ability to manipulate objects on a continuous basis with one and/or both hands.
  • Ability to frequently push and pull up to 15 pounds, with occasional heavy pushing and pulling of fully loaded carts and palletized items up to 50 pounds.
